Sri Lanka, July 16 -- New job opportunities in Japan have opened up for Sri Lankan youth, with relevant agreements already signed.

These agreements are expected to provide significant opportunities, particularly in the nursing care sector.

The Sri Lanka Bureau of Foreign Employment (SLBFE) announced that a group of young women is scheduled to depart for Japan today(16).
